Description

It would be convenient to have more control around the edit process.

My motivating example is to differentiate display-value vs edit-value; for example display a formatted currency string "$1,234.50", but present the raw number (1234.5) for editing.

I can think of a few possibilities off the top of my head to implement this:

  • an optional format function
  • different properties for display and editing values
  • a callback fired before editing starts
  • (more involved) a different component for editing, meaning you could also use a select list on edit, or a colour picker, etc

I'm not sure which might be the best solution, if this is desirable functionality, but I'm happy to work on a patch for feedback if necessary.
